This mouth-watering Quinoa Chickpea Salad recipe will have you drooling. It includes cucumbers, tomatoes, red onions, and chickpeas, and it's easy to make—it takes less than 20 minutes.
Add quinoa to a medium sized saucepan and rinse. Fill the saucepan with 1 cup of water and a pinch of salt. Bring the water to a boil and cook on a low heat for 8-10 minutes. Leave to cool.
Add the cooled quinoa, chickpeas, cucumber, tomatoes, onions to a large bowl. Season with salt, pepper and lemon juice. Add a few drops of olive oil and mix.
Notes
Add-ins: You can get creative with this dish by adding your favorite vegetables, such as red peppers, peas, asparagus, broccoli, carrots, and more.
Chickpeas: You can use dried chickpeas for this recipe. Just follow the cooking instructions on the packaging.
Swaps: For a different twist, you can substitute the chickpeas with black beans, lentils, or kidney beans.
